Easy Fruit Salsa Recipe for Kids

We love how this red salsa goes along with our Elmo theme (because it’s red) and it’s healthy too!

What you need to make Cinnamon Chips:

  • 4 uncooked tortillas
  • 2 tablespoons butter, melted
  • 2 tablespoons granulated s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on

What to do:

1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ees . Using a pizza cutter or a pastry cutter, slice tortillas into wedges.

2. Place wedges on 2 baking sheets lined with parchment paper. Brush each wedge with melted butter. Combine cinnamon and sugar and sprinkle over the tops of all the wedges.

3.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the tortilla chips are crisp and golden brown. Allow to cool or serve warm with the salsa.

What you need to makeĀ  Fruit Salsa

  • 2 peaches, cut and peeled
  • 6 cherries, pits and stems removed
  • 5 strawberries, leaves and stems removed

What to do

1. Put all ingredients into a food processor and pulse until all is finely chopped.
